This article introduces the purpose and configuration method of "Ignore unknown characters". Usually refer to this article when you need to change the default behavior of the device, adapt to the business system, or find the corresponding configuration barcode.
"Unknown characters" refer to characters that are not recognized by the host computer. When "Send barcodes containing unknown characters" is selected, the decoder will send all barcode data except unknown characters without emitting an error beep; when "Do not send barcodes containing unknown characters" is selected, the decoder will only send the data before the first unknown character is encountered and emit an error beep.
